ABOUT WFP:

The United Nations World Food Programme is the world's largest humanitarian agency fighting hunger worldwide.  The mission of WFP is to help the world achieve Zero Hunger in our lifetimes.  Every day, WFP works worldwide to ensure that no child goes to bed hungry and that the poorest and most vulnerable, particularly women and children, can access the nutritious food they need.

WFP Sudan has the potential to reach millions of food insecure people across Sudan – with a total of 7.8 million people assisted in 2018. WFP Sudan, one of the largest and complex operations for WFP globally,  is currently rolling out its five-year Country Strategic Plan (2019-2023), which aims to provide emergency assistance through a hybrid approach (Cash, food and vouchers), along with life-changing types of programmes (Nutrition, Resilience and School Feeding).

JOB PURPOSE:

SCOPE is WFP’s beneficiary identity and benefit management system (cloud-based digital solution) that helps WFP know better the people we serve, so the assistance we provide can be more targeted and appropriate. SCOPE is used to register people, calibrate entitlements, deliver the assistance, and subsequently manage the operational data coming in providing a responsive information system to guide effective programming across all transfer modalities (food or cash).

To purpose of this position is to provide support to policy and programme activities that effectively meet food or cash assistance needs.
